1. Cleansing
A thorough cleanse is the foundation of any skincare routine. For combination oily skin, opt for a gentle, pH-balanced cleanser that won't strip your skin of its natural oils. Some popular options include:
- La Roche-Posay Effaclar Purifying Foaming Gel
- Neutrogena Oil-Free Acne Wash
- Cetaphil Gentle Skin Cleanser
1. Toning
Toning helps to remove any remaining impurities and balance the pH levels of your skin. Look for toners with ingredients like witch hazel, glycolic acid, or salicylic acid to target excess oil and tighten pores. Our top picks include:
- Thayers Alcohol-Free Witch Hazel with Aloe Vera
- The Ordinary Salicylic Acid Solution 2%
- La Roche-Posay Effaclar Purifying Lotion
1. Serums
Serums are concentrated formulas designed to deliver targeted ingredients deep into the skin. For combination oily skin, we recommend incorporating the following serums into your routine:
- Paula's Choice Skin Perfecting 2% BHA Liquid Exfoliant: This exfoliating serum helps to unclog pores and reduce acne breakouts.
- Drunk Elephant C-Firma Day Serum: A vitamin C-infused serum that brightens, protects, and helps to minimize the appearance of pores.
- COSRX Advanced Snail 96 Mucin Power Essence: This snail mucin serum helps to hydrate, soothe, and reduce inflammation.
1. Moisturizing
Moisturizing is crucial for maintaining a healthy balance in combination oily skin. Choose a lightweight, oil-free moisturizer that won't clog your pores or exacerbate oil production. Our favorite options include:

1. Sun Protection
Sun damage is a leading cause of premature aging and skin cancer. Make sure to ap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of at least 30 daily. Some great options for combination oily skin include:
- EltaMD UV Clear Broad-Spectrum SPF 46
- La Roche-Posay Anthelios Clear Skin Dry Touch Sunscreen SPF 60
- Neutrogena Clear Face Liquid Lotion Sunscreen SPF 55
1. Exfoliation
Regular exfoliation is essential for removing dead skin cells and preventing clogged pores. Use a chemical exfoliant like a glycolic or salicylic acid serum one to two times a week. Our top picks include:
- The Ordinary Glycolic Acid 7% Toning Solution
- Paula's Choice Skin Perfecting 2% BHA Liquid Exfoliant
- COSRX AHA/BHA Clarifying Treatment Toner
1. Masking
Weekly masking can help to deep clean pores, control oil production, and provide additional hydration or exfoliation. Some great options for combination oily skin include:
- Innisfree Jeju Volcanic Pore Clay Mask
- Bioderma Sébium Global Anti-Imperfection Mask
- La Roche-Posay Effaclar Purifying Mask
